OracleSQL查询基础与删除约束操作示例
下载需积分: 3 | PPT格式 | 3.5MB |
更新于2024-08-15
| 74 浏览量 | 举报
"删除约束举例-Oracle SQL的ppt"
在这个Oracle SQL的PPT教程中,主要介绍了如何在数据库中删除约束以及SQL的基本查询操作。针对初学者,它提供了丰富的实例来帮助理解各种概念。
首先,删除约束是数据库管理中的一个关键操作。在Oracle SQL中,我们可以使用`ALTER TABLE`语句来删除表上的约束。例如,要从名为`child`的表中删除一个名为`c_fk`的约束,你可以执行以下命令:
```sql
SQL> ALTER TABLE child DROP CONSTRAINT c_fk;
```
这个命令会移除`c_fk`约束,这可能是外键、唯一性约束或检查约束等,从而允许数据不再受该约束的限制。
接下来,PPT深入介绍了SQL查询的基础知识。`SELECT`语句是SQL中最基础也最重要的部分,用于从数据库中检索数据。基本的`SELECT`查询语法如下:
```sql
SELECT <列名>
FROM <表名>;
```
例如,如果你想从`s_emp`表中获取所有员工的信息,你可以使用:
```sql
SQL> SELECT * FROM s_emp;
```
这里的`*`通配符代表选择所有列。
更具体地,你可以选择查询特定列,如部门ID和工资:
```sql
SQL> SELECT dept_id, salary FROM s_emp;
```
此外,`SELECT`语句还支持使用算术表达式来处理数值数据。例如,要计算员工的年薪(假设`salary`字段代表月工资),你可以这样做:
```sql
SQL> SELECT salary * 12 FROM s_emp;
```
注意,当在表达式中使用多个运算符时,可以使用括号来控制运算的优先级,避免误解。例如:
```sql
-- 第一种方式,先乘后加
SQL> SELECT last_name, salary, 12 * salary + 100 FROM s_emp;
-- 第二种方式,先加后乘
SQL> SELECT last_name, salary, 12 * (salary + 100) FROM s_emp;
```
这些示例展示了如何在查询中结合使用字段、运算符和表达式来生成复杂的计算结果。
这份Oracle SQL的PPT教程为初学者提供了一个很好的起点,涵盖了删除约束的基本操作以及基础的查询技巧,帮助学习者逐步掌握数据库管理和数据检索的核心技能。
相关推荐
![filetype](https://img-home.csdnimg.cn/images/20241231044955.png)
![filetype](https://img-home.csdnimg.cn/images/20241231044937.png)
![filetype](https://img-home.csdnimg.cn/images/20241231044955.png)
![filetype](https://img-home.csdnimg.cn/images/20241231044937.png)
![filetype](https://img-home.csdnimg.cn/images/20210720083606.png)
![filetype](https://img-home.csdnimg.cn/images/20241231044937.png)
![](https://profile-avatar.csdnimg.cn/85d7ccf9d44f4c99bcd94421e5c4a9af_weixin_42203796.jpg!1)
Pa1nk1LLeR
- 粉丝: 69
最新资源
- iBATIS SQLMap2开发指南:入门与配置详解
- SQL基础教程:操作数据库与ASP编程
- Oracle 数据库优化技巧: constraint 约束管理
- Oracle数据库常见问题与解答
- C#网络编程入门与Socket使用详解
- 《Div+CSS布局大全》技术整理
- SQL语句优化:避开IN与LIKE陷阱
- Ajax:革新Web设计的实战指南
- InfoQ中文站:深入浅出Struts 2 免费在线阅读
- 汤子瀛《计算机操作系统》习题答案详解:批处理、分时与实时系统
- 数据库系统概论课后习题详解
- JavaScript常用方法:好友列表与个人数据获取
- ACCP试题 - 图书管理系统开发
- 北大青鸟C语言考试复习与实战题目详解
- C++标准库教程与参考:深入理解与实践
- SQL:关系数据库的标准语言